What I read on the MozillaZine knowledge base is that the word Body is only in the list when you have a POP3 account, but that it is possible to add it when you have an IMAP account and that it still works. My problem is that this kind of information is sometimes not up to date, and that the removal of the Body keyword in the IMAP account may have been the first step of removal of the feature of body text search that maybe is no longer present in the current version. A further problem is that all other words in this list are translated to my local language, and it may be that I do not have to add "Body" but some other word like "Berichttekst" that I do not know. So I may have tried with the wrong keywords.
